Operative IQ - Comprehensive Analysis Report



Summary


Operative IQ is an operations management platform specializing in enhancing the efficiency of emergency service providers and various first response industries. Founded in 2007 as AmbuTRAK, the company rebranded in 2013 to offer a comprehensive suite of solutions beyond initial medical supply inventory tracking. Operative IQ's mission is to lead the industry by providing innovative personal services that empower First Responders with the intelligence, time, and financial resources to maximize operational efficiency. The platform is significant in its industry for its purpose-built solutions that streamline complex workflows and ensure "service readiness" for clients including fire departments, EMS agencies, law enforcement, air medical agencies, hospitals, educational programs, and veterinary clinics.

3. Product Pipeline


Key Products/Services


Operative IQ consistently introduces new modules and applications to support its customers.

  • Inventory & Asset Management

  • Description: Helps agencies gain total control over inventory and assets, track usage, monitor asset locations, and make data-driven purchasing decisions. It also allows for scheduling maintenance for high-value equipment.

  • Development Stage: Mature and continuously improved.

  • Target Market/Condition: Fire departments, EMS agencies, law enforcement, hospitals, educational programs, and veterinary clinics.

  • Key Features and Benefits: Automated tracking, historical data, expense tracking, and purchasing integration. Reduces costs on expired supplies and streamlines supply requests.


  • Narcotics Tracking Software

  • Description: A digital system that replaces paper logbooks, offering cradle-to-grave chain of custody tracking with multiple security measures for DEA compliance.

  • Development Stage: Continuously enhanced since its introduction in 2014.

  • Target Market/Condition: First responder agencies, particularly EMS and law enforcement.

  • Key Features and Benefits: DEA compliance, electronic logging, security measures, and easy auditing of narcotics safes.


  • RFID Solutions

  • Description: Advanced RFID technology for automated inventory counts, tracking critical assets, and managing narcotics safes.

  • Development Stage: Continuously expanding, with new solutions like Smart Shelves introduced in 2023.

  • Target Market/Condition: All first responder agencies seeking to automate manual inventory processes and improve accuracy.

  • Key Features and Benefits: Saves time, improves accuracy of inventory counts, tracks critical assets, and automates audits.


  • Operative IQ Front Line (Introduced 2022)

  • Description: A responsive mobile-first application for field operations across various devices, designed for field personnel to capture data, perform inspections, submit requisitions, record narcotics administrations, and monitor inventory.

  • Development Stage: Actively developed and improved since its 2022 launch.

  • Target Market/Condition: Field personnel in fire, EMS, and law enforcement.

  • Key Features and Benefits: Mobile accessibility, real-time data capture, streamlined field operations, and compliance on the go.


  • Facilities Management Software (Launched 2023-2024)

  • Description: Centralizes facility-related information and maintenance schedules, allowing organizations to upload data, establish maintenance schedules, and create custom inspection forms.

  • Development Stage: Recently launched and awarded.

  • Target Market/Condition: Agencies with multiple facilities, including fire stations, hospitals, and administrative buildings.

  • Key Features and Benefits: Centralized information, guided inspections, maintenance scheduling, and streamlined facility oversight.


  • Blood Tracking Software (Introduced 2025)

  • Description: Designed to manage blood transfusions safely and efficiently, providing real-time tracking of blood products with integrated temperature monitoring.

  • Development Stage: Recently introduced in 2025.

  • Target Market/Condition: EMS agencies, hospitals, and any organization involved in blood product management.

  • Key Features and Benefits: Real-time tracking, lifecycle management, temperature monitoring, and enhanced safety and compliance.


  • Fleet Maintenance and Telematics

  • Description: Manages scheduled maintenance and ad-hoc repair requests efficiently, with the ability to create schedules based on vehicle types, odometer readings, or usage hours. Integrates with telematics providers for real-time fleet visibility.

  • Development Stage: Mature, with continuous improvements planned.

  • Target Market/Condition: Fire, EMS, and law enforcement agencies with vehicle fleets.

  • Key Features and Benefits: Proactive maintenance, reduced downtime, extended vehicle lifespan, real-time telematics data, and improved operational efficiency.


  • Service Desk

  • Description: Provides an internal help desk to streamline communication and keep everyone informed of issues and their resolution. Users can submit tickets directly to specific departments.

  • Development Stage: Mature and integrated across the platform.

  • Target Market/Condition: Internal administrative and operational teams within first responder agencies.

  • Key Features and Benefits: Improved communication, efficient issue resolution, and centralized tracking of requests.


4. Technology & Innovation


Technology Stack


Operative IQ differentiates itself through a suite of proprietary technologies and methodologies tailored for critical operations.
  • RFID Solutions: Utilizes advanced RFID technology for automated inventory counts, tracking critical assets, and managing narcotics safes, including the Operative IQ Smart Shelves for real-time inventory and RFID Maintenance Automation.

  • Controlled Substance Tracking: Features a digital Narcotics Tracking system that replaces paper logbooks, offering cradle-to-grave chain of custody tracking with multiple security measures for DEA compliance.

  • Mobile-First Application Development: The Operative IQ Front Line application supports field personnel on various mobile, desktop, and tablet devices for data capture, inspections, and inventory monitoring.

  • Centralized Data Platforms: The Facilities Management module centralizes all facility-related information, maintenance schedules, and guided inspections.

  • Real-time Tracking and Monitoring: The Blood Tracking Software incorporates real-time tracking of blood products with integrated temperature monitoring.


The company holds an inactive patent related to a controlled substance tracking system and method (Publication ID US-20160323273-A1) with a first filing date of April 30, 2015.

8. Recognition and Awards


Industry Recognition


Operative IQ has received significant industry recognition for its innovative solutions.
  • EMS World Innovation Awards: The company has earned six EMS World Innovation Awards. Recent awards include recognition for its Facilities Management module in 2024. Previous awards include:

  • Narcotics Tracking module (2014)

  • IQ Genius (2015)

  • IQ Mobile (2016)

  • RFID Drug Safe (2017)

  • RFID Solutions (2017)

  • RFID Maintenance Automation (2020)

  • Cobb Chamber of Commerce: Honored as a Top 25 Small Business of the Year by the Cobb Chamber of Commerce.

  • Inc. 5000 List: Recognized on the Inc. 5000 list for four consecutive years as of 2022, highlighting its consistent revenue growth.

11. Strategic Partnerships


Operative IQ has established a robust network of strategic collaborations and partnerships to enhance its offerings and provide integrated solutions to customers.

  • Purchasing Integration Partners:

  • Partner Organizations: Bound Tree Medical, McKesson, Life-Assist, Medline, Henry Schein, Office Depot, and Grainger.

  • Nature of Partnership: Collaborations to streamline purchasing processes by enabling direct purchase order submission and automated inventory receipt.

  • Strategic Benefits: Reduces duplicate data entry, paperwork, administrative headaches, and leads to faster, more accurate purchasing.

  • Collaborative Achievements: Seamless integration for ordering medical supplies and everyday office essentials. Additional partnerships with IDS Vending and VendNovation provide automated solutions for controlled dispensing through vending machines.


  • Software Integration Partners:

  • Partner Organizations: Geotab, Samsara, and Motive.

  • Nature of Partnership: Telematics providers offering real-time fleet visibility, GPS tracking, and maintenance alerts.
